5 roses in Dubai: the errands this count is actually for
A small count carries no announcement, which is precisely its use. It goes to a colleague on an ordinary morning, to a neighbour who watered your plants, to a doctor or a teacher where a large armful would create an obligation, or alongside a present where the flowers are the smaller half of the gift.
It fails in the opposite setting. On a laid table, at a formal presentation or anywhere the bunch is seen from more than a few paces, five roses disappear among the objects around them. No amount of paper rescues that.
The awkward middle case is a gift that will be photographed. Five heads fill a frame at arm's length and read as nothing at all across a room, so the choice depends on which of those two pictures anybody actually wants.

What the drive does to a small bunch
Delivery across the city takes 2 to 4 hours. In summer the air outside reaches 40 °C and the coast adds humidity. We pack insulated and keep the bouquet out of direct sun. On five stems that layer barely adds any weight, which is one place a small count is easier than a large one. It is also the count with the least in reserve, so a bunch left standing on a step in high summer loses more than a big one would.
The last stretch is the part worth naming when you order. Between a vehicle and a lobby door there is always some open ground, and on five stems that walk is the one piece of the route we cannot pack against.
- A place out of direct sun, if the bunch waits anywhere before it reaches water.
- A glass or a low ceramic vessel, which is all a short cut asks for.
- The floor and the desk number, if the delivery is going into an office tower.
Where these actually land in the city
An office in DIFC or Business Bay is the most common address for this count. The bunch sits on a desk without taking half of it, and it obliges nobody to go looking for a bucket in front of colleagues.
An apartment in Marina, JBR or Downtown is the other regular. Five stems go into whatever the kitchen already has. Somebody living alone in a small flat finds that easier than a large armful wanting space, a vessel and rearranging in the first minutes after the handover.
Hotels are the exception. Address Downtown, Four Seasons or Atlantis The Palm take a small bunch without any of the logistics a large one needs, though at a family date on Palm Jumeirah the same five stems can vanish among everything else on the table.

Greenery, and why we keep it light
Two stems of greenery already outweigh the flowers at this size, and what arrives is a mixed arrangement with roses inside it. Greenery is the first thing people add when they want a bunch to look larger. It works up to a point and then quietly changes what the gift is. If the recipient wants more presence, a longer cut and a larger head do more than any filler.
Dutch roses arrive at 60 to 90 cm and Ecuadorian stems reach 120 cm, so the taller build is there whenever the room can take it.
